MMEX Resources Corp. said it plans to produce hydrogen and sequester carbon at one of its existing crude oil and distillation sites in West Texas, with an eye to expanding operations across the state.

MMEX Resources

The Fort Stockton, TX-based operator focuses on acquiring, developing and financing oil and gas refining and infrastructure projects in Texas and South America. It recently announced plans to modify the business to incorporate “clean energy use and production.”

“We announced negotiations with a European co-developer partner to develop and finance a hydrogen project with carbon capture” at the Pecos County site, CEO Jack W. Hanks said.
